Heads up, plugin folks: the Burrowlark ingest service is chatty, so we sample logs hard. Debug lines get kept at 1%, info at 10%, and warnings and errors always make it through. If your plugin needs a trace, request a sampling override rather than spamming. Full sampling rules and the override form are documented here.

operations page: https://jira.qorvelsys.internal/browse/pages/browse/pages

Finance Review Summary — For the Incoming Director

The shift of Quillbase customers to annual billing is largely complete. About 68% of accounts converted, improving cash collection by roughly nine weeks on average. Churn among converted accounts is flat. Remaining monthly accounts are mostly small and low-margin. The migration informs a wider decision now pending.

management briefing: The renewal with Zoraelax Group closes at $10 million a year, 15 percent below the last contract. Project Ralael slips by six weeks because of the audit delay.

The appointment reminder job at Fernvale Health runs as a scheduled container built exclusively by the Larchgate pipeline. Source is pulled from the protected release branch, dependencies resolve from the internal mirror only, and the resulting image is signed at build time. No manual pushes to the registry are permitted; the registry rejects unsigned images. Reviewers can reconstruct any deployed version from the attestation bundle. The attestation for the currently deployed image is anchored to the token below.

trace token, kahog-tajeg: htk6_97d963

### Relevance Tuning Notes

Plugin authors targeting the Seabright search API should not hardcode ranking weights; the core engine rescales them per index. Field boosts apply before the freshness decay, and plugin-supplied signals are clamped to the documented range. Exceeding the clamp logs a warning and truncates silently. Test against the staging index first. The platform defaults your plugin inherits are shown below.

tuning constants:
THRESHOLDS = {
    "briael": 916,
    "gilox": 448,
    "eliion": 485,
    "brivan": 771,
    "casdor": 265,
}